Fiber optics up to 1000 Mbit/s for AON, GPON and XGS-PON
Network with 1 x 2.5 gigabit LAN and 2 x gigabit LAN
Interfaces
Wireless router with an SFP port for a FRITZ!SFP fiber optic module (AON and GPON included, ready for XGS-PON)
1 x 2.5 gigabit LAN port (IEEE 802.3bz standard, NBASE-T)
2 x 1 gigabit LAN ports
Wi-Fi 6 (5 GHz, 2.4 GHz)
Integrated DECT base station for up to six cordless telephones
1 a/b port (TAE/RJ11) for analog phones, answering machines and fax
Fiber optics
FRITZ!SFP AON
ITU-T G.652; IEEE 802.3ah-2004 1000BASE-BX10
LC/APC 8°
Wavelength: TX 1310 nm, RX 1480 to 1580 nm
Full duplex transmission
Transmitter power: -9 to -3 dBm
Reception range: -3 to -23 dBm
Range: 10 km
Support for SFF-8472
Class 1 laser
FRITZ!SFP GPON
Suitable for ITU-T G.984.2/984.5 (GPON)
LC/APC 8°
Wavelength: TX 1310 nm, RX 1490 nm (with filter)
Suitable for rogue detection
Transmitter power: 0.5 to 5 dBm
Reception range: -3 to -28 dBm
Range: 20 km
Support for SFF-8472
Class 1 laser
